George Werner 1893–1965 – Genealogical Records

Birth Date: 2 Nov 1893

Birth Location: Württemberg, Germany

Death Date: Nov 1965

Death Location: New York, New York, USA

Father: Friedrich Werner

Mother: Susanna Hamel

Spouse(s): Jessie Beaton

Children(s): John Werner, Constance Werner, George Jr

In 1893, George Werner entered the world in Württemberg, Germany, born to Friedrich Werner And Susanna Catharina Hamel. George Werner married Jessie A Beaton, and had children including Constance Margaret Werner, George John Werner Jr, John Joseph Werner. George Werner passed away in 1965 in New York, New York, USA.
